FAQs

Q: What does 'Not Seasonally Adjusted' mean?

A: Represents raw employment data without statistical modifications to remove seasonal variations.

Q: Why use non-seasonally adjusted data?

A: Provides unfiltered view of labor market changes, useful for detailed economic research.

Q: How differs from seasonally adjusted data?

A: Includes natural fluctuations from seasonal factors like holidays and weather patterns.

Q: Who uses this type of data?

A: Economists, researchers, and analysts seeking granular labor market insights.

Q: How frequently is this data updated?

A: Typically updated monthly by the Bureau of Labor Statistics.
